Profile

Senior Tax Accountant The candidate will be responsible for federal, international, and state tax accounting and compliance activities, research relating to tax accounting matters, and oversight for IRS Audits. Responsible for Oracle and onesource provision and compliance technical support. Prepare federal, state and international income tax, franchise, qualified benefit returns, and annual reports. Prepare the quarterly and annual federal, international, state and local tax provisions. Prepare monthly journal entries of tax accruals and book/tax differences, and generate quarterly analysis of fixed assets for tax books. Prepare quarterly federal, international, and state tax payments. Prepare LIFO inventory calculations. Oversee IRS and state audits and respond to information requests on a timely basis. Research federal and state taxing issues. Responsible for the preparation of the quarterly and annual federal and international tax provisions. Prepare federal tax return (ZDI and ZCORP), and facilitate the preparation of the Puerto Rican and Canadian tax returns by working with outside consultants. Review federal tax returns (all others except ZDI and ZCORP). Review US and international account reconciliations. Responsible for supporting federal and international audits. Responsible for the preparation of the quarterly and annual state and local tax provisions. Responsible for the preparation of unitary state tax returns. Review Sep. Co. State Tax Returns. Responsible for supporting state and local audits. Responsible for all matters concerning FIN 48. Review all state accounting reconciliations. Correspond with state tax authorities from all states. Ensures that all state audits are performed correctly. Special projects: State and local planning and matrices for decision making. Lead the onesource provision and Compliance technical support. Lead Oracle (tax) Technical Support. Responsible for the review of work related to fixed assets. Bachelor Degree in accounting, finance or business (certain prior work experience may be given credit). CPA preferred. Masters in Tax, MBA, JD, LLM degree is a plus. Must have 4-6 years of progressive experience in federal, state and/or international taxation. Prior experience with income tax return compliance, audit administration, research and modeling is essential.
